L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) is a remote sensing method that uses light in the form of a pulsed laser to measure variable distances to the Earth. When integrated into drones, LiDAR technology provides accurate 3D mapping and surveying capabilities.
A drone equipped with a LiDAR system can create highly detailed maps for various applications such as land surveying, agriculture, forestry, infrastructure inspection, and more. The key benefits include improved accuracy, efficiency, and the ability to penetrate dense vegetation to capture detailed topographic information.
When selecting a drone LiDAR system, factors to consider include the drone's compatibility with the LiDAR sensor, the range and accuracy of the LiDAR system, software integration, and overall cost. It's essential to choose a system that meets the specific requirements of your project.
Drone LiDAR systems are widely used in various industries such as urban planning, construction, environmental monitoring, and emergency response. These systems help professionals collect accurate data efficiently, making them valuable tools in many fields.
